Public works begins data collection for 44th Avenue resurfacing; staff notes conference and permits report
Summary
Director of Public Works Dave Schultz said Bolton & Menk has begun collecting data for a potential resurfacing east of 44th Avenue; consultant Matt Mohs will present a task order at a May meeting. City Administrator Dan Matejka noted the League of Minnesota Cities conference and presented the March building permit summary and EDA minutes.

Director of Public Works Dave Schultz told the council that Bolton & Menk has started collecting data needed for a potential resurfacing project east of 44th Avenue. Mr. Matt Mohs of Bolton & Menk is scheduled to attend a May council meeting to present a task order describing the consultant's proposed scope of work and deliverables.
City Administrator Dan Matejka reminded council members that the 2025 League of Minnesota Cities annual conference will be held in Duluth June 25-27 and asked those who wish to attend to notify him for registration. The council was also presented with the March 2025 building permit summary report and the EDA minutes from March 12, 2025. Notices included the Maintenance Department on-call schedule for May and a notice of the Southeast Minnesota League of Municipalities spring meeting in Caledonia on April 29.
The meeting packet also listed fund totals and claims: General Fund $187,461.11; Economic Development (EDA) $100.00; Water Service Fund $49,718.51; Sewer Service Fund $25,378.10; Grand Total $262,657.72. The minutes do not include further discussion of these amounts.
